Desde muy peque a, Josefina Jarama sue a con una vida mejor y sabe que para llegar hasta ella solo hay una v a, cruda y pragm tica: el ascenso social. Este Lazarillo moderno comienza su andadura en una f brica de juguetes en Ibi, Alicante. All es la protegida del jefe y adem s trabaja junto a su madre, una comunista militante que opera en la clandestinidad y que deber huir para que no la encarcelen. La protagonista ha de elegir entonces entre su madre o sus sue os en la f brica, y elige. Con Josefina y su peripecia, el lector recorre varias d cadas de nuestra historia reciente, diversos puntos calientes del «milagro espa ol y, sobre todo, varias vidas. Animosa, descacharrante y nica, Josefina hace realidad un sue o que no se ha propuesto: llegar al coraz n. This modern Lazarillo begins her journey in a toy factory in Ibi, Alicante. There she's the boss' prot g and she also works with her mother, a militant communist who operates underground and who must flee to avoid imprisonment. The protagonist then must choose between her mother or her dreams in the factory, and she makes her choice. With Josefina and her adventures, the reader travels through several decades of our recent history, various hot spots of the "Spanish miracle" and, above all, several lives. Courageous, hilarious, and unique, Josefina makes a dream come true that she has not set out to do: to reach our hearts.
